A graph is a simple but fundamental data structure with which many real-world applications can be efficiently modelled, such as social network, purchase network, spatial-temporal network, biological network, material science, knowledge graph, and so forth. This project focuses on new learning methods for expressing graph structures using neural network called ¡°Graph Neural Networks¡±.
